As the Whitefish Mountain Resort Race Team prepares for the ski season to get under way, organizers will hold an informational meeting for all interested Dec. 3 at The Whitefish Library.
The Whitefish Mountain Resort Race Team conducts season-long alpine racing programs for young athletes. The team features programs for all levels of participants in one, two, three or four, day-per-week configurations, and provides support for racing locally, statewide, nationally and even internationally.
The Race Team programs are operated by Whitefish Mountain Resort, and are also supported by the Flathead Valley Ski Education Foundation (FVSEF). The FVSEF is a non-profit, volunteer-run organization with a mission to support skiing in the Flathead Valley.
This year, the race team has expanded into an option for young athletes that are serious about pursuing a career in ski racing: the Whitefish Ski Academy. The academy is a joint venture with Whitefish Mountain Resort, the local school system and the FVSEF.
“The Academy is in place for more committed Alpine and Freestyle athletes,” said head coach Roy Loman. “The schools have agreed to restructure their schedules to allow more on-snow training time for these motivated athletes.”
The team is hosting an orientation, information and sign-up meeting at the Whitefish Community Library on Wednesday, Dec. 3 from 6:00 p.m. - 8:00 p.m. Anyone interested and their family members are welcome.
